Which statement is an enlightment idea that jefferson used in the declaration of independence

History
1 answer:
Pepsi [2]3 years ago
6 0

Jefferson used the Enlightenment ideals in the Declaration of Independence such a natural right, birth rights, all men are created equal.

Explanation:

In the Declaration of Independence, Jefferson operated the idea of "unfair rights" in similar to the idea of natural rights, which comes from Locke. According to him (Locke) there are many rights with which people are born and these rights cannot be taken away by the government.

Similar to Locke, Jefferson stated that all men (people) are created with equal rights and they should be treated equally. Thus, this situation is helpful for the peaceful growth of country and citizens.

Why was the Spanish American war considered a turning point in American history
nasty-shy [4]

Answer:

The brief war fought against the Spanish Navy and land forces in 1898 established the United States as a global, major navy and military power.

The war was fought in Cuba - the Caribbean - and in the Pacific.  If a century before American governments were not willing to join wars among European powers and pursued a cautious diplomacy, full industrialization, territorial expansion and a fantastic growth of economic might made the United States a player in world affairs to be reckoned with a century later. That´s why the Spanish-American war is a turning point in American history: the US would play a large role in world affairs from that moment on.

How did the heliocentric theory of the universe differ from the geocentric theory?
otez555 [7]
The heliocentric theory of the universe differed from the geocentric theory is that the heliocentric theory put the Sun in the middle of the Universe, whereas the geocentric theory put the Earth in the center, which was the go-to theory for the Church throughout a great deal of history.

Why is Andrew carngie famous
DENIUS [597]

He was an industrialist and philanthropist. He got his fortune in the steel industry by creating the Carnegie Steel Company and he revolutionized the way steel is produced in the U.S.
